Besiktas will look to end their slump with a win over Bodrumspor in their first-ever meeting, as the two sides clash in round 19 of the Turkish Super Lig on Saturday.

The Black Eagles, still without a permanent manager since Giovanni van Bronckhorst's dismissal on November 30, have struggled to improve on the sixth-place position they held when the Dutchman departed.

Match preview

Interim boss Serdar Topraktepe has yet to spark a revival for Besiktas, managing just one win in five league matches during his tenure, alongside three draws and one defeat.

The lowest point of this run came in a shocking 2-1 loss to bottom-placed Adana Demirspor, who had not won a game all season, after which the Black Eagles have recorded back-to-back 1-1 draws against Alanyaspor and Caykur Rizespor.

Their draw with Rizespor marked Besiktas's first match of 2025, and they followed it up with a hard-fought 1-0 victory over Sivasspor in the Turkish Cup, leaving them unbeaten so far in the new calendar year.

Topraktepe will be eager to build on this momentum by securing consecutive victories for the first time since October, when Besiktas defeated Konyaspor in the Super Lig and Lyon in the Europa League.

While the hosts are clear favourites, their inconsistency at Vodafone Park raises questions about their ability to secure all three points, having won just once in their last four competitive home matches, a stat that may give their opponents hope.

Bodrumspor, however, have been woeful on the road this season, picking up just four points from a possible 24 - the joint second-worst record in the league - while currently on a four-match away losing streak.

The visitors have also undergone managerial upheaval, with Volkan Demirel replacing Ismet Tasdemir earlier this season - however, the change has not yielded the desired results, as Bodrumspor have slipped from 13th to 17th under Demirel's guidance.

In seven league matches, Demirel has overseen just one win, alongside four losses and two draws, with their most recent Super Lig match ending 1-1 against Kayserispor, marking their first competitive outing of 2025.

Bodrumspor were also involved in a thrilling 4-4 draw with third-division side Kirklarelispor in the Turkish Cup earlier this week, and while this means they are unbeaten in 2025, their inability to win remains a concern.

Team News

Besiktas continue to grapple with several injury absences, including Tayyip Talha Sanuc, who is sidelined with a hamstring injury and will not return until February, while Gabriel Paulista remains doubtful with a tendon rupture.

Necip Uysal is out until March due to a long-term ligament issue, while Jean Onana and Emrecan Terzi are unavailable with muscle injuries, and Milot Rashica is sidelined with an ankle problem.

For Bodrumspor, Mustafa Erdilman, Suleyman Ozdamar and Tunahan Akpinar remain out with no confirmed return dates.

Additionally, Taulant Seferi is suspended for this clash after accumulating too many yellow cards.
